Output 8563d58ce08a8e81ac293d4d44bbdb1d3720bb009468ded6705b3086e7bef8bd:1

value
511094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b22d83879c249d6071c70dbe59be20b499efd7 OP_EQUAL
address
32D8kWgsT2ujGkTgyg53DoCb2o25yZUZun
transaction
8563d58ce08a8e81ac293d4d44bbdb1d3720bb009468ded6705b3086e7bef8bd
spent
true